We have a database that sits on a shared directory on our server. As of last night we keep getting the following error message.

Could not use H:\projects\projects.mdb file already in use.

Noone is in the database. Please help! :)

Hi

Has someone crashed out of the db leaving the lock file in place, look in same folder as mdb, for a file with extension .ldb, if you are SURE noone is in db, then delete the .LDB

If that does not do it, would it be too much disruption to restart the server ?
